The Dream of Red Mansions is a classic Chinese novel that tells the story of a wealthy family during the Qing dynasty.
The novel has been adapted into various forms of art, including Kunqu opera, which is a traditional form of Chinese opera that originated in the Ming dynasty.
Kunqu opera is known for its graceful movements, beautiful singing, and elaborate costumes.
